Mission Delhi – One Percent in 13 Million

Bus No. 522

Cracking the city.

[Text and picture by Mayank Austen Soofi]

You don’t understand a city by its buildings and bazaars, but by its people. That’s why you can’t take in the entire Delhi in one lifetime – we have 13 million souls here.

The Delhi Walla plans to make portraits of one per cent of this 8-digit figure, that is 1, 30, 000 Delhiwallas. Each portrait will have a photograph of the person along with a peek into his life.

By the time I finish the project (just assuming), the looks and the lives of most people I will photograph and profile is bound to change. You may wonder then, what is the point?

People are not ruins. They evolve over the years. Trying to sketch a person at a moment in his/her life is not to mummify him/her, but to get a sense of the city, his/her city.

So I will search for people like you. You can be anyone. You may be living in a Defence Colony barsati or in a Seelampur shanty. You may be from Bihar or Kerala. You may be a vice chancellor. You may be a prostitute. You may be a rich man’s daughter. You may be a content housewife. You may be bisexual. You may be asexual. I’m interested in you all. I want to portray all of you… oh no, just one per cent of you.

But one lakh and thirty thousand portraits… possible?

Inshallah. God willing.
